Company Overview:


  • WELL is an omnichannel digital health company whose overarching objective is to empower doctors and healthcare workers to provide the best and most advanced care possible while leveraging the latest trends in digital health. As such, WELL owns and operates primary and executive healthcare clinics in both Canada and the US. Operating a global digital Electronic Medical Records (EMR) business serving thousands of healthcare clinics and health systems of all sizes and operates a multinational portfolio of telehealth services which includes one of the largest telehealth service providers in Canada. WELL is also a provider of digital health, billing, and cybersecurityrelated technology solutions. WELL's whollyowned subsidiary CRH Medical provides various products and services that have supported thousands of Gastroenterology physicians in the US. The Compensation and Benefits Specialist will be a member of the P&C Shared Services team, involved with designing, managing and supporting the Total Rewards, Compensation and Benefits programs. The goal is to attract, retain and motivate highquality employees while reducing turnover and enhancing our company's profile as the best place to work.
